…ages Fixes metadata fetching to handle edge cases and provide clear error messages when URLs return incorrect or malformed content. Changes: - Ignore Content-Type headers completely (GitHub raw URLs serve JSON as text/plain) - Parse JSON in two steps to distinguish syntax errors from schema errors - Show clear schema-only errors for valid JSON with wrong structure - Preserve dual-format errors for truly malformed content - Add empty body detection with clear error message - Refactor test infrastructure with MetadataServerBuilder pattern - Improve MetadataServer API ergonomics (add_cli_args instead of cli_args) Error message improvements: Before: "failed to parse as JSON (missing field) or OpenMetrics (...)" After: "valid JSON but incorrect schema: missing field `pub_key`" This fixes validator registration with GitHub-hosted metadata files while maintaining backward compatibility with all metadata sources.

Replace string-based error handling with typed MetadataError enum. URL context is added by callers via .with_context() following idiomatic Rust error handling patterns. Changes: - Add MetadataError enum (SchemaError, BothFormatsFailed, EmptyBody, FetchError) - Callers add URL context: preview-metadata, validate_metadata_uri() - Replace string assertions with assert_matches! for type safety - Add integration tests verifying users see URLs in error output - Document when each error variant occurs Error messages now show which URL failed: "from http://example.com/metadata: valid JSON but incorrect schema: missing field `pub_key`" Makes production debugging easier for validators while maintaining clean, idiomatic error handling.
